Women often turn to a Mommy Makeover after the birth of a child, when they are unable to obtain the body that they had prior to the pregnancy. Breast augmentation is a big part of the Mommy Makeover. For the breast augmentation part of the Mommy Makeover, Dr. Stapenhorst may use one of two types of implants – silicone or saline. Silicone implants are a silicone shell filled with silicone gel while the saline implants are a silicone shell filled with saline fluid. Some women might also benefit from a breast lift to elevate the position of the nipple on the breast. In addition to breast procedures, other procedures such as a tummy tuck or liposuction are also typically performed during a Mommy Makeover.

How does Dr. David Stapenhorst perform the Mommy Makeover procedure?

Mommy Makeovers are performed with a general anesthetic which means that the patient is asleep during the procedure. Dr. Stapenhorst will make breast incisions in the breast fold or in the areola to put the implant in the breast cavity. These may be altered depending on the patient. All incisions are closed with dissolving stitches. If there is a liposuction or tummy tuck included in the Makeover procedure, there are additional incisions and stitches included. Once all the procedures are concluded, the patient has bandages placed for healing and is placed in a post-surgical room until they wake up. The length of a Mommy Makeover varies greatly depending on the number of procedures done and the complexity of the surgery. Women should be in good overall health and not smoke prior to the surgery so that they have optimum healing after the surgery is completed.

When can normal activities resume after the Mommy Makeover procedure?

Depending on the extent of the procedures performed Dr. Stapenhorst prefers that his Mommy Makeover patients restrict their daily activities for a minimum of five days following the surgery. Those having this procedure should avoid sleeping on their stomach for approximately three weeks and excess activity such as exercising and lifting of more than ten pounds for six weeks after the procedure. For the best results, patients need to have someone stay with them for the first 24 hours after the surgery so they can rest and relax, giving the body ample time to heal.  Most patients return to desk job type work in two weeks.

Is there any pain associated with the Mommy Makeover procedure?

Some of Dr. Stapenhorst’s patients report having mild discomfort and swelling after a Mommy Makeover procedure. Because of this, he may prescribe a medication for the pain to help keep the patient comfortable. Dr. Stapenhorst provides his patients with a post-operative surgical bra and a post-operative body garment to wear as the breasts and incisions heal.
